nectar
BrE /ˈnek.tə/ AmE /ˈnek.tɚ/
noun en → es
the sweet liquid produced by plants and eaten by bees to make honey
néctar
Collocations nectar of flowers
-
Bees collect nectar from the flowers.
Las abejas recogen néctar de las flores.
used to refer to something that is very sweet or pleasant, like nectar
algo muy dulce o agradable
Collocations nectar of the gods
-
The food was like nectar to her after days without eating.
La comida fue como néctar para ella después de días sin comer.
